The head of Hamas Political Bureau Ismail Haniya called Monday evening the Turkish Foreign Minister Mevlut Cavusoglu in an attempt to foil the US draft resolution condemning the Palestinian resistance in the UN General Assembly. 
Haniya said that the US draft resolution violated the international laws and resolutions that legalised resisting the occupation by all means possible. 
The top Hamas leader said that this resolution came as part of the Israeli-biased US policy, which targets the Palestinian national rights and constants, including the US decision to move its embassy to Jerusalem, cutting all UNRWA funds to liquidate the Palestinian refugees’ right to return to their homeland, and delegitimising the Palestinian people’s right to defend themselves, as well as criminalising the Palestinian resistance. 
The Turkish FM, on the other hand, stressed that his country has been exerting enormous efforts through its mission to the UN General Assembly to fight off this resolution.  
Cavusoglu noted that Turkey would “do all what is needed to block this resolution” adding that his country, that took a constant stance towards the Palestinian cause, would always support the Palestinian people and their rights.
